For more information about the 3.11.y.z tree, see https://wiki.ubuntu.com/Kernel/Dev/ExtendedStable Thanks. -Luis ------ From a9acbb32982cc5c93bb646bb9135946adee347e3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Oleg Nesterov Date: Wed, 2 Apr 2014 17:45:05 +0200 Subject: pid_namespace: pidns_get() should check task_active_pid_ns() != NULL commit d23082257d83e4bc89727d5aedee197e907999d2 upstream. pidns_get()->get_pid_ns() can hit ns == NULL. This task_struct can't go away, but task_active_pid_ns(task) is NULL if release_task(task) was already called. Alternatively we could change get_pid_ns(ns) to check ns != NULL, but it seems that other callers are fine. Signed-off-by: Oleg Nesterov Cc: Eric W.
